Oracle RAC 添加共享硬盘

2023-02-23 00:00:00 设置 硬盘 点击 添加 虚拟机

概述:

在笔记本上安装了虚拟机(VMware),并在其中安装了两套Linux系统用于安装Oracle RAC,由于安装RAC需要共用的投标文件、数据文件,现通过VMware添加硬盘。


  1. 两台虚拟机(RAC01、RAC02),添加新的额外盘时,需要关机Linux(我是在RAC01上进行添加盘,新建操作
现有环境

2. 点击“编辑虚拟机设置”,弹出【虚拟机设置】窗口,在点击“添加”按钮,会弹出【添加硬件向导】,选中硬盘,在点击“下一步”

3. 分别对每块盘进行修改,如下:

选中一块盘,然后点击“”,在【硬盘设置】框中的 “模式”属性中选中“独立”

修改后

4.在另外一台Linux(RAC02)上添加上面创建的硬盘,步骤如下:

点击“编辑虚拟机设置”在弹出的【虚拟机设置】框中,点击“添加”,然后会弹出【添加硬件向导】,选中“硬盘”,在点击“下一步”

注意:下面的截图中选择的是“使用现有虚拟磁盘(E)”,这里选择之前在Linux(RAC01)中已经创建的虚拟磁盘。

在RAC02中,对每一块盘,进行如下操作:

设置之后的如下:


上述相关配置,均配置完成后,分别启动操作系统:RAC01、RAC02。

在启动RAC01之后,在启动RAC02的时候,出现如下错误:

现对上面提示的错误信息,进行处理:

  1. 关闭操作系统:RAC01、RAC02
  2. 修改 RAC01、RAC02虚拟机目录下的vmx配置文件(这里已RAC01为演示)
修改 RAC01.vmx文件
在vmx文件的尾部添加如下内容:
disk.locking = "false"
diskLib.dataCacheMaxSize = "0"
diskLib.dataCacheMaxReadAheadSize = "0"
diskLib.DataCacheMinReadAheadSize = "0"
diskLib.dataCachePageSize = "4096"
diskLib.maxUnsyncedWrites = "0"

相关文章